#f625f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f625fe is composed of 96.5% red, 14.5%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.1% cyan, 85.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 297.8 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 57.1%. #f625fe color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4aff with #ed00fd. Closest websafe color is: #ff33ff.

#f625fe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f625fe has RGB values of R:246, G:37,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 16131582.
